Retaining Wall Demolition in Sacramento, CA
Retaining wall demolition services involve the careful removal of existing retaining walls that no longer serve their purpose or need replacement. These projects typically include tearing down concrete, stone, or timber walls that are part of landscape designs, property boundaries, or erosion control systems. Homeowners often request this service when planning yard renovations, addressing structural issues, or preparing a site for new landscaping features. Understanding the type of wall, its construction materials, and the surrounding landscape can help property owners determine the scope of demolition needed and ensure the process is safe and efficient.
Before requesting retaining wall demolition, property owners should consider factors such as access to the site, potential impact on nearby structures, and any necessary permits or regulations in Sacramento, CA. It’s also helpful to know the condition of the existing wall, including whether it is damaged or unstable, to assess the complexity of removal. Clear communication about the desired outcome, whether it involves complete removal or partial demolition for reconstruction, will support a smoother process and ensure the project aligns with overall property plans.

Retaining Wall Demolition Questions
What is involved in retaining wall demolition? The process includes removing existing retaining walls, clearing debris, and preparing the area for new landscaping or construction.
When should a retaining wall be demolished? Demolition is needed when the wall is damaged, no longer serves its purpose, or needs replacement due to age or structural issues.
Are there any considerations before demolishing a retaining wall? It's important to assess the surrounding landscape, utilities, and soil stability to ensure safe and effective demolition.
What types of retaining walls are typically demolished? Various types, including concrete, stone, and timber walls, can be removed depending on their construction and condition.
